the beginning of 1975 the population of a country was 40 million and growing at a rate of 3% per year. Assume that the growth is exponential. Estimate the population of the country at the beginning of the year 2010

This can be taken as a geometric progression where the population at any given year is given by \[ar ^{n-1}\] where a is starting population and 'r' in this case is 1.03 as the population is increasing. Now count the years, from 1975 to 2010, 35 years. So you use formula population = \[40000000\times1.03^{35}\] population approx 112 million
